MBOC Modulation and Its Performance Analysis in Galileo System
WANG Chao1,HAO Ran1,KAN Hai-bo2(1.The 54th Research institute of CETC,Shijiazhuang Hebei 050081,China;2.The Unit 61081 of PLA,Beijing 100094,China)
MBOC(Multiplexed Binary Offset Carrier) is an optimized modulation recommended for GALILEO L1 OS and GPS LIC.Compared with BOC,MBOC spreading modulation provides more high frequency power,so it can improve the pseudorange precision and mitigate the multipath effect.CBOC(Composite Binary Offset Carrier) signal is adopted for Galileo.This paper introduces the power spectral density and autocorrelation of MBOC modulation,then analyses its additional benefits including code tracking in noise and mitigation of multipath effect through MAT LAB simulation.
